Bank of America, founded in 1904 as the Bank of Italy by Amadeo Giannini to serve immigrants in San Francisco, is now one of the largest financial institutions in the world, headquartered in Charlotte, North Carolina, following its 1998 merger with NationsBank. It provides a broad spectrum of services, including consumer banking, wealth management (through its Merrill division), commercial banking, and investment banking, managing trillions in assets and serving millions of customers globally.

Bank of America's Q3 2024 Portfolio in Review

As of Q3 2024, Bank of America held 8,612 positions worth $1.24T, up 10% from $1.13T the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 17% of the portfolio.

Bank of America deployed $44.3B of net new capital in Q3 2024, opening 416 new positions and adding to 4,188 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was Smurfit Westrock: 6,225,524 shares worth $308M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 15% of assets, down from 15% a quarter earlier, followed by Financials and Healthcare.

On the sell side, the largest reduction was Goldman Sachs, an estimated $998M trimmed.
